UnitedHealthcare Community Plan of New Jersey has appointed Jocelyn Chisholm Carter as its CEO, it announced recently.
Carter has been with the Minnesota-based insurer for the past 13 years. Most recently, she served as the CEO of the Community Plan of Mississippi. In her new role, she will manage all aspects of clinical, quality and operation effectiveness, as well as maintain contract compliance and leverage relationships with state partners.
Prior to joining UnitedHealthcare, she served as an assistant district attorney in New York City.
UnitedHealthcare is one of the largest providers of health insurance to New Jersey residents. Last year, it signed a deal with Hackensack Meridian Health to form the Accountable Care Program, which uses data and technology to better coordinate patient care, manage chronic health conditions and address missed patient care opportunities.
